Eatontown, NJ – A man wanted in Honduras for homicide is now in federal custody after immigration agents located and arrested him in Monmouth County. Fredy Alexander Lopez Lara was detained by U.S. Immigration and Customs Enforcement (ICE) officers on April 20 and remains held pending removal proceedings. ICE Enforcement and Removal Operations (ERO) Newark confirmed the arrest, identifying Lopez Lara as a Honduran national with an active homicide warrant in his home country. Authorities said he was found in Eatontown and taken into custody without incident. Arrest Tied to International Homicide Case According to ICE ERO Newark, Lopez Lara is wanted by Honduran authorities in connection with a homicide case. Officials have not released details about when the alleged crime occurred or the circumstances surrounding the case. The arrest places Lopez Lara among a number of individuals with serious criminal allegations abroad who have been detained by federal immigration authorities in New Jersey in recent months. Custody and Next Steps ICE officials stated that Lopez Lara will remain in custody while removal proceedings move forward.
